wind mitigation Deltona LakesWind mitigation plays a major role in Deltona Lakes home insurance pricing because the area includes older homes with limited wind‑resistant features and newer builds with stronger construction. Many homeowners compare Deltona Lakes home insurance options to understand how wind mitigation affects eligibility. Homes built in the 2000s and newer often include reinforced roof‑to‑wall connections and improved decking, while older homes may lack these features.

Carriers evaluate roof shape, roof covering type, underlayment, and opening protection when reviewing wind mitigation reports. Hip roofs generally perform better in high winds and often receive more favorable pricing than gable roofs. Why Wind Mitigation Matters in Deltona Lakes

Wind mitigation reduces long‑term insurance costs by lowering the likelihood of roof failure, water intrusion, and structural damage during storms. Homes with impact windows, reinforced decking, and improved roof‑to‑wall connections often receive substantial discounts. Older homes without these features may face higher premiums or fewer carrier options.

Completing recommended upgrades—such as adding a secondary water barrier or installing shutters—can help homeowners secure better pricing and more stable coverage.
